Summary

When Desmond Miles is called away on an urgent mission, he entrusts fellow Assassin Jonathan Hawk with File 24. Hawk sets out to search for the Scepter of Isis – a powerful ancient artifact, lost in time. Through his Assassin ancestor, El Cakr, Hawk travels to Egypt in 1257, where the Scepter lies in the hands of the new Sultan. Pursued in the present by the formidable Templar agent Vernon Hest, Hawk finds himself in a race against time…throughout time.

About The Author

Eric Corbeyran

For more than twenty years Eric Corbeyran has written successful bande dessinée scripts. Boundless curiosity and fascination for varied art-forms have led him to explore a multitude of stories.
